Ingredients
Base
- 7 tablespoons unsalted butter
- 1 1/2 cups crushed graham crackers (about 9 whole crackers)
- 3 tablespoons granulated sugar
Filling
- 225g cream cheese, at room temperature
- 1 cup confectioners’ sugar
- 1 teaspoon pure vanilla extract
- 1 jar of chilled whipped cream, 225g
- 1 tin cherry pie filling, 600g
Preparation
Base
Place the butter in a medium bowl. Microwave for 30 seconds or until melted. Add the crushed Graham crackers and sugar and mix well to combine. Firmly press the bran mixture into the bottom of a greased 20x20cm baking dish. Set aside.
Filling
Place the cream cheese in a large bowl. Beat with an electric mixer until the cream cheese is soft and lump-free. Add the powdered sugar and vanilla and mix well. Stir in the chilled whipped cream and whisk until the whipped cream and cream cheese combine, but do not overmix.
Spread the filling evenly over the Graham cracker base, using a spoon or angled spatula. Place the cherry pie filling on top and carefully spread evenly over the filling.
Chill for at least 2 hours before serving. I prefer to leave it overnight.
Store leftovers in the refrigerator.
